Well W.I. Simonson is where I got my car from and they were bsing me to buying stupid service and get extended warranty and literally lying to my face.

Keyes European was stupid because had to take my transmission 3 times before they were convinced that they need to change valve body. They said my oil consumption is fine. Topped it off and told me to come back. They checked with dipstick and said it's fine without doing a road test or measuring oil.

House of Imports said the same thing althought they did do a consumption test and they said .4 quarts I am burning every 1k mile and this is fine. I didn't think so since none of the m272 guys have this issue. Then when my warranty was running out I was desperate and checked whole engine for leaks and found it. So they were stupid because they didn't even look at the car.

I've had bad experience with all these dealers. STAR in Glendale is the worst one. A lot of people I know have the worst thing to say about them.

In the end I say F them all. They are all crooks.
